英文摘要
The research to be conducted here centers around models for the structure and evolutionof giant planets which can be used to relate observations of giant exoplanets tofundamental properties such as mass and radius. First, a modeling effort will beundertaken to compute the thermal evolution of young giant planets over a range ofmasses in a self-consistent way, i.e., coupled with core accretion models, rather than withthe arbitrary initial conditions currently used. From these models, both spectra and colorswill be calculated to allow for more accurate determinations of the masses of youngobjects found orbiting other stars. A second project will explore recent revisions in theequation of state for hydrogen to evaluate the corresponding changes in model radius. Itis suggested that this change leads to larger radii at a given age and that the wide spreadin radii seen among transiting extrasolar giant planets may be understood in terms of alarge range in interior heavy element abundances versus the need for internal energysources.This work will improve the return of future space missions to locate extrasolar planets aswell as efforts from the ground by enabling more accurate determinations of basicproperties from observations. The models here will also serve as a stepping stone to theeventual detection of Earth-like planets. The results of this work will be posted on theSETI Institute website and disseminated to the public through articles in popular journals.
